Computer and Information Science and Engineering Graduate Fellowships (CSGrad 4 US)

NSF fellowship for early-career individuals pursuing a research-based doctoral degree in computer and information science and engineering.

Deadline
May 31
Award amount
$159,000 for three years of support
Eligibility
US citizens, nationals, or permanent residents; Bachelor's degree before January 1 of the year applying; Demonstrated CISE core competency; Not enrolled in any degree-granting program after January 1 of the year applying; No prior doctoral program enrollment or pending applications
Requirements
Personal statement (max 3 pages); Reference letter (2-page PDF); Transcripts from all degree-granting programs; Resume (2-page PDF); Must meet all eligibility criteria
Application materials
Application information (personal, demographic, education, history); Personal Statement—Relevant Background Experience; Reference Letter; Transcript PDF(s); Resume
How to apply
Submit applications via NSF ETAP; Create an account on research.gov; Complete the application form; Submit reference letters through ETAP; Ensure all materials are submitted by the deadline
Important dates
Application deadline: May 31; Mentored preparation program begins in Fall; Matriculation into doctoral program within two years of acceptance
